To provide a treating device capable of efficiently disposing of a wet waste with a low load on environments.
This ventilation-type grinding/drying device comprises a cylindrical disposal container which is rotatable and hermetically contains the waste to be disposed of and stirs it, a blade which is arranged in the container and rotates, centered around an axis in parallel with the rotary shaft of the container and further, stirs/grinds the waste falling by its own weight after being conveyed and moved by the rotation, an arc-like plate which is positioned below leaving a slight gap on the outside of a track of a blade tip and grinds the waste using a constriction stress and a centrifugal force generated between the blade tip and the waste and further, has many small holes for the ground waste to pass through, an air supply means for supplying air into the disposal container and an air discharging means which discharges the air present in the container to its outside.
